Summary
The White Serpent is a literary work[1]. It is known by 4 alternative names across languages and contexts.[2]
Key Facts
- The White Serpent authored Tanith Lee[3].
- The White Serpent's instance of is recorded as literary work[4].
- The White Serpent's genre is fantasy[5].
- The White Serpent followed Anackire[6].
- The White Serpent's part of the series is recorded as The Wars of Vis[7].
- The White Serpent's language of work or name is recorded as English[8].
- The White Serpent was released on April 1988[9].
- The White Serpent's nominated for is recorded as Locus Award for Best Fantasy Novel[10].
- The White Serpent's title is recorded as The White Serpent[11].
- The White Serpent's uses is recorded as fantasy map[12].
- The White Serpent's form of creative work is recorded as novel[13].
